Ukhamati Nepali - Gogamukh, Dhemaji
Ukhamati Nepali is a village situated in the Gogamukh subdivision of Dhemaji district, Assam. It is located approximately 4 km from the tehsil headquarters in Gogamukh and around 34 km from the district headquarters in Dhemaji. Dirpai Mohoricamp serves as the Gram Panchayat for Ukhamati Nepali village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Ukhamati Nepali is 289722. The village covers a total geographical area of 389.15 hectares and falls under the 787035 pincode. Dhemaji is the nearest town, located about 34 km away.
Ukhamati Nepali village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Dhemaji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Lakhimpur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Ukhamati Nepali
As per Census 2011, Ukhamati Nepali village has a total population of 2,138 people, consisting of 1,107 males and 1,031 females. The village has 443 households and a sex ratio of 931 females per 1,000 males. There are 263 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 1,410 literate and 728 illiterate residents. Additionally, 55 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 109 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Ukhamati Nepali
Ukhamati Nepali is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ared van services. The nearest railway station is located within 5-10 km of Ukhamati Nepali.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Private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Railway Station | No | Available within 5-10 km |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Dhemaji to Ukhamati Nepali is about 34 km, with a usual travel time of around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
